The St. Bonaventure Seraphs had to endure a three-game losing streak, but that streak is no more. They came out on top against Valley by a score of 68-58 on Thursday. The victory was all the more spectacular given St. Bonaventure's disadvantage in MaxPreps's basketball rankings in their respective home states (they are ranked 370th in California, while Valley is ranked 44th in Nevada).
St. Bonaventure's win was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Jeremy Goodcase, who scored 24 points along with seven rebounds. Those 24 points set a new season-high mark for him. The team also got some help courtesy of Dylan Benner, who scored 18 points along with five assists and five rebounds.
St. Bonaventure's victory bumped their record up to 8-5. As for Valley, they are on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 3-5.
